I need to know if anyone else has heard of this:
2003 Ram 2500 QC 4x4, completely stock, + synthetic fluids and Bosch platinum plugs.
The engine shut off with no warning of any kind. Then, before I could get off the highway, it re-started all by itself. I didn't try to turn the key, and I didn't have it in neutral yet - it just fired back up. The trip odometer and mileage readings had reset to 0, and all the radio presets were gone, so it seems the entire electrical system dropped out. I went straight to the dealer (still under warranty at that time) and they told me there was nothing wrong, because no trouble codes were set.
A couple of weeks ago, the check engine light came on. When I had it read, it showed an evaporative emissions problem (this was fixed under warranty 2 years ago, but now is back). I don't remember the exact code number. I haven't been able to get it fixed yet because of my work schedule - last time it took 3 days for the dealer to fix it.
This morning, nothing happened when I turned the key - no lights, no ignition, nothing. I tried again, and still got nothing. The third time I turned the key, there was a slight delay, then the truck started normally. But again, the odom and mileage were reset to 0, and the radio presets were erased.
Can anyone tell me what is happening? The local dealership is clueless.

I too have electrical problems in my Ram. I get all or some of my instrument gauges go to zero and return to normal. I also get check engine lights with 036 codes (crank sensor) but after changing the sensor it all comes back again. Now after I drive for more than an hour my engine stumbles occasionally as if I turned the key to the off position and back. I might add that I have a Banks six gun system now for two years and that might be part of the problem. i am so sick of dealing with this that I am ready to sell it.
